US Central Command (CENTCOM) has completed its investigation of
the incident at the Palestine Hotel in Baghdad on 8 April 2003 in
which Ukrainian Reuters cameraman Taras Protsyuk and Spanish
Telecinco cameraman Jose Couso died.
The investigation concluded that a tank
crew "properly fired upon a suspected enemy
hunter/killer team in a proportionate and justifiably measured
response. The action was fully in accordance with the Rules of
Engagement."
"The journalists' deaths at the Palestine Hotel was a
tragedy and the United States has the deepest sympathies for the
families of those who were killed," CENTCOM added.
The Brussels-based International Federation of Journalists
described the Pentagon report as a "cynical
whitewash" of the affair.
For its part, Reporters Without Borders today described the
report as "unacceptable".
